
This comparison is for buyers deciding between Yunzii's two 75% wireless keyboards. The choice is difficult because both share a compact layout, tri-mode connectivity, hot-swap PCB, and PBT keycaps. The decision hinges on whether you prioritize a premium, dampened typing experience or a specific switch type, as the models differ in their mounting style, internal construction, and available switch options.

For most users, the Yunzii YZ84 Pro is the recommended choice due to its upgraded gasket mount construction, sound-dampening features, and superior battery life. These improvements justify its position as the more premium model. Only choose the standard YZ84 if you have a strong preference for clicky switches, as that is its sole clear advantage over the Pro variant.
The YZ84 Pro is the more versatile choice, winning in scenarios where a quieter, more refined typing experience and longer battery life are critical, such as for office use and travel. It also holds an edge for modders due to its gasket mount and pre-installed foams. The standard YZ84 remains relevant for users who specifically desire clicky switch options, a feature absent from the Pro model. For programming and content creation, the shared core features make them equally capable.
